IBM: IBM Study Finds Consumers Prefer a Mobile Device Over the PC
ARMONK, NY (MARKET WIRE) IBM (NYSE: IBM) today released new survey results which reveal that over 50 percent of consumers would substitute their Internet usage on a PC for a mobile device. Expanding on the May 2008 "Go Mobile, Grow" study produced by IBM's Institute for Business Value, the survey identifies new findings that validate previous conclusions on how consumers will be open to full adoption of the mobile device as the hub for Internet activity.

Marketwire.com Thursday, October 23, 2008Avid Technology, Inc.: Avid Announces Third Quarter 2008 Results and Continued Business Transformation
TEWKSBURY, MA (MARKET WIRE) Avid technology, Inc. (NASDAQ: AVID) today reported revenue of $217.1 million for the three-month period ended September 30, 2008, compared to $226.8 million for the same period in 2007. GAAP net loss for the quarter was $66.4 million, or $1.80 per share, compared to GAAP net loss of $5.9 million, or $.14 per share, in the third quarter of 2007.
